Advanced Topics in Theatre: British Feminist Theatre

ENGL 271.950
instructor(s):

Cross-listed as Theater Arts 275.950
This course is an introduction to feminist theatre, focusing on the creative and political efforts of feminist playwrights, performers, and performing ensembles in England. Our readings will offer background on feminist theatre theory and history; we will study the plays of such writers as Caryl Churchill and Timberlake Wertenbaker, and the productions of such companies as the Women's Theatre Group and the Monstrous Regiment.

The course will be conducted in a seminar format, with heavy emphasis on class participation. Students will be responsible for leading discussions and making oral presentations; there may also be an opportunity for in-class performances. The writing requirement for the course will be one ten-page paper. Whenever possible, this class will draw on productions seen in "The London Theatre Experience," and on field trips and other resources available to us in London.
